Skip to content
Snabbit

文字列のアンエスケープ

バックスラッシュのエスケープシーケンスを読みやすいテキストに戻します。

文字列のアンエスケープでは何ができますか?

文字列のアンエスケープとは、バックスラッシュのエスケープシーケンスを元の文字に戻す処理です。\n は実際の改行に、\" は引用符に変換されます。Snabbit は \t、\xNN、\uXXXX、\u{...} の各形式にも対応し、元の読みやすいテキストを復元します。すべてブラウザ内で動作するため、デコードした内容はお使いのデバイスから外に出ず安全です。

文字列のアンエスケープの使い方

  1. 1 デコードしたいエスケープ済みの文字列を貼り付けます。
  2. 2 アンエスケープされた読みやすいテキストが即座に表示されます。
  3. 3 \n、\t、\uXXXX などのシーケンスが実際の文字に変換されます。
  4. 4 デコードしたテキストをコピーします。

活用できる場面

  • ログやJSONの値に含まれるエスケープ済み文字列を読む。
  • \n シーケンスを実際の改行に戻す。
  • ソースコードからコピーしたテキストを復元する。
  • 文字列エスケープ処理の結果を確認する。

よくある質問

どのエスケープ形式が認識されますか?
\n、\t、\r などの短いエスケープに加え、16進数(\xNN)、4桁のUnicode(\uXXXX)、コードポイント(\u{...})の各シーケンスがすべて文字に戻されます。
未知のエスケープはどうなりますか?
バックスラッシュの後ろに特別な意味を持たない文字が続く場合、その文字はそのまま保持されるため、テキストが失われることはありません。
URLやHTMLのデコードとはどう違いますか?
これはバックスラッシュによる文字列エスケープを逆変換するもので、パーセントエンコーディングやHTMLエンティティとは異なります。それらの形式にはURLツールやHTMLツールをお使いください。

関連する検索

文字列のアンエスケープや類似ツールを探すときによく使われる検索キーワード:

  • 文字列 アンエスケープ オンライン
  • 文字列 アンエスケープ c#
  • json文字列 アンエスケープ オンライン
  • c# 文字列 アンエスケープ オンライン
  • 文字列 アンエスケープ js
  • 文字列 アンエスケープ php
  • 文字列 アンエスケープ json
  • 文字列 アンエスケープ java
  • json文字列 アンエスケープ
  • 文字列 アンエスケープ ツール
  • 文字列 デコード オンライン
  • 文字列 アンエスケープ python

関連ツール